2. What is a Cryptocurrency Platform?

A cryptocurrency platform is a digital marketplace where users can buy, sell, and trade cryptocurrencies. These platforms provide various features, such as exchange services, wallet integration, and educational resources, to facilitate the cryptocurrency experience.

4. Top Cryptocurrency Platforms by Ease of Use

4.1 Coinbase

Coinbase is a popular cryptocurrency platform known for its user-friendly interface and extensive educational resources. It supports a wide range of cryptocurrencies, including Bitcoin, Ethereum, and Litecoin. Users can easily buy, sell, and trade cryptocurrencies using their credit/debit cards or bank accounts.

User Interface (UI): Coinbase boasts a clean and straightforward UI, making it easy for beginners to navigate the platform.

User Experience (UX): The platform offers a seamless experience, with minimal complexity in its transactions.

Educational Resources: Coinbase provides an abundance of educational content, including guides, videos, and webinars, to help users understand the basics of cryptocurrencies.

Customer Support: The platform offers 24/7 customer support through email, phone, and chat.

Security Features: Coinbase employs advanced security measures, such as two-factor authentication and cold storage for most of its assets.

4.2 Binance

Binance is a highly popular cryptocurrency platform, known for its advanced trading features and low fees. It offers a vast range of cryptocurrencies and supports users from over 180 countries.

User Interface (UI): Binance's UI is sleek and modern, but it can be overwhelming for beginners due to its complexity.

User Experience (UX): The platform's advanced trading features may require some time to learn, but the overall experience is smooth.

Educational Resources: Binance provides educational resources, including tutorials and webinars, but they are not as comprehensive as Coinbase's.

Customer Support: Binance offers 24/7 customer support through email and chat, but the response time can be slow at times.

Security Features: Binance employs robust security measures, such as cold storage for most of its assets and multi-factor authentication.

4.3 Kraken

Kraken is a well-established cryptocurrency platform, known for its security and reliability. It offers a variety of cryptocurrencies and is popular among both beginners and experienced traders.

User Interface (UI): Kraken's UI is clean and straightforward, making it easy to navigate for beginners.

User Experience (UX): The platform provides a smooth experience, with minimal complexity in its transactions.

Educational Resources: Kraken offers educational resources, including tutorials and webinars, but they are not as comprehensive as Coinbase's.

Customer Support: Kraken provides 24/7 customer support through email, phone, and chat.

Security Features: Kraken employs advanced security measures, such as cold storage for most of its assets and two-factor authentication.

4. What is the difference between a spot market and a futures market in cryptocurrency trading?

- A spot market allows users to buy and sell cryptocurrencies at their current market price, while a futures market allows users to buy or sell cryptocurrencies at a predetermined price in the future.

7. What is the difference between a limit order and a market order in cryptocurrency trading?

- A limit order allows you to set a specific price at which you want to buy or sell a cryptocurrency, while a market order executes your trade at the current market price.
